6-10. FILTER PUMP & MOTOR
Nov. 2009
The 2 most common causes for a fryer not to pump oil are that
the pump is clogged, or the thermal overload switch has been
tripped on the motor. The pump and motor is located on the
rear of the fryer.
To reset the thermal overload switch:
1. Remove the right side panel and locate the pump and motor
in the rear of the fryer. If the motor is hot, allow it to cool
for about 5 minutes.
2. Since it takes some effort to reset the switch, use a tool,
such as a Phillip's-head screwdriver, to press against the
reset button until a "click" is heard.
To remove debris from pump:
1. Loosen the four Allen head screws on the end of pump and
remove the cover. (Removing the bottom rear panel may
help in accessing the set screws.)
2. The inside is now exposed leaving a rotor and five teflon
rollers. Clean the rotor and rollers.
3. To reassemble, place rotor on drive shaft, and place roller
into rotor.
A small amount of grease might be needed to hold the
bottom roller into place until cover plate is put on. Make
sure O-ring is in proper position on plate.
Indicators, on the side of the two halves of the pump, must
allign together.
